New hope for glioblastoma: drug infused directly into brain shows promise
NCT ID NCT02861898
First seen Jun 25, 2026 · Last updated Jun 27, 2026 · Updated 1 time
Summary
This trial tests a new way to treat glioblastoma, an aggressive brain cancer. The drug cetuximab, which blocks a protein that helps tumors grow, is infused directly into the brain's arteries after temporarily opening the blood-brain barrier. Up to 33 newly diagnosed patients will receive this treatment alongside standard chemo and radiation. The goal is to see if this approach is safe and improves survival.

- Active substance
- cetuximab (a drug that blocks a protein called EGFR, often found on glioblastoma cells)
- What this could lead to
- If it works, this could offer a new way to treat glioblastoma by delivering the drug directly to the brain, potentially improving survival beyond current standard care.
- What could go wrong
- This is an early-phase trial with only 33 participants, so results may not apply to all patients. The treatment involves repeated infusions and blood-brain barrier disruption, which carries risks like brain swelling or toxicity.
